WebIf you would prefer the first layer to be squished, a value of -0.05mm will be a good start. For a layer height of 0.2mm, this will give about 25% squish. Another way to think of this is that 100% of your extrusion will be forced into a space that is 75% of the layer height. For the test print, we set the First Layer height to 100%. Print grooves left in bed with no filament and/or flaky or intermittent lines of filament on the first and subsequent layers. Cause 1. Incorrect extruder calibration/offset. Suggested Solutions 1. Prime extruder. Adjust nozzle height.
